Centrifugal Pump Operation Manual:
Centrifugal pumps convert rotational energy from an impeller into kinetic energy, generating centrifugal force to move fluids. Proper selection and operation depend on understanding this hydrodynamic principle and its relationship to pump performance curves.
Key parameters for centrifugal pump specification include:
Flow Rate (Q) - Required volumetric capacity (m³/h or GPM)
Total Dynamic Head (TDH) - Net pressure differential accounting for static lift, friction losses, and system resistance
Fluid Properties - Viscosity, specific gravity, temperature, and chemical compatibility with wetted materials
Net Positive Suction Head (NPSH) - Critical to prevent cavitation (NPSH> NPSH+ safety margin)
Foundation - Rigid mounting base with vibration-damping provisions (grouted sole plates or isolation pads)
Alignment - Laser-aligned shaft coupling within 0.05mm tolerance (per ANSI/HI standards)
Piping -
Suction line: Short, straight runs with eccentric reducers (flat-top orientation)
Discharge: Install check valve and isolation gate valve
Support independent piping loads to prevent nozzle strain
Parameter | Normal Range | Corrective Action if Deviated |
---|---|---|
Discharge Pressure | ±10% of BEP | Check for clogging/valve position |
Bearing Temp | <70°C (158°F) | Relubricate or replace bearings |
Vibration Velocity | <4.5 mm/s RMS (ISO 10816) | Verify alignment/impeller balance |
Current Draw | Within motor nameplate | Assess fluid density/motor condition |
Daily:
Inspect mechanical seal/gland packing for leaks
Monitor lube oil levels (oil-lubricated bearings)
Log pump performance metrics
Monthly:
Grease bearings (quantity per OEM specs)
Flush seal chambers on abrasive services
Conduct motor megohm testing
Annual:
Replace wear rings if clearance exceeds 0.5mm
Perform dynamic balancing (ISO 1940 G6.3 standard)
Hydrotest casing at 1.5x design pressure
Symptom | Root Cause | Resolution |
---|---|---|
No liquid delivery | Priming failure/NPSH deficiency | Vent air, elevate suction source |
Excessive noise | Cavitation or bearing failure | Increase NPSH, replace bearings |
Seal leakage >5 drops/min | Seal face wear or misalignment | Reface/seal replacement, realign |
Power surge | Impeller blockage | Disassemble and clean flow passages |
